Qiu Lihua, MD, professor and doctoral tutor, is now a chief physician and the associate director of Obs. & Gyn. Department, Ren Ji Hospital, School of Medicine, Shanghai Jiao Tong University. Dr. Qiu used to be a visiting scholar at the Providence College, USA and the University of Sydney, Australia.
Dr. Qiu’ is professional at diagnosis and treatment of gynecological oncology, precancerous lesions of cervix, vaginal intraepithelial neoplasia, lesions of vulva and infection of lower genital tract. From 2005 to now, Dr. Qiu works as Editorial Board Member of Chinese Journal of Practical Gynecology, Tumour and Obstetrics and Journal of International Reproductive Health/Family Planning. At present, Dr. Qiu is a member of Gynecological Oncology Branch of Chinese Medical Association, vice director member of the Youth Committee of Chinese Obstetricians and Gynecologists Association, vice director member of Gynecological Oncology Branch of Shanghai Medical Association, member of Chinese Society for Colposcopy and Cervical Pathology of China Healthy Birth Science Association.
Dr. Qiu’s research interests focus on gynecological oncology, such as the mechanism of tumor microenvironment regulating metastasis and drug resistance in epithelial ovarian cancer and clinical as well as basic research on the effects of vaginal microorganism and cervical HPV infection on cervical lesions. She hosted 4 projects of National Natural Science Foundation of China and got the support from Clinical Research Innovation and Cultivation Fund of Renji Hospital, Shanghai Jiao Tong University, School of Medicine, Shanghai Science and Technology Innovation Action Plan and Project of Shanghai Municipal Education Commission – Gaofeng Clinical Medicine Grant Support. Dr. Qiu had a total of more than 70 research papers published, in which more than 20 were published in SCI cited journals and she was as the first author or corresponding author. In addition, she was also authorized one national invention patents.
As regard to the honors and rewards, Dr. Qiu won Second Prize of 2008 National Science and Technology Progress Award, Second Prize of 2009 Shanghai Medical Science and Technology Award, Third Prize of 2009 Shanghai Science and Technology Progress Award, Second Prize of 2010 Ministry of Education, Science and Technology Progress Award and First Prize of 2017 Shanghai Science and Technology Progress Award.
